Database dan Sistem Manajemen Database

Slides:



Advertisements
Presentasi serupa
Akhmad Dahlan, S.Kom Semester Gasal Tahun Ajaran 2009 – 2010 Sekolah Tinggi Manajemen Informatika dan Komputer AMIKOM Yogyakarta.
Advertisements

SISTEM BASIS DATA Basis Data.
Continous DBMS DATA MODELS
Manajemen Sumber Daya Data
Oleh : Suparno Blog : Organisasi File Pengenalan Pengolahan Data Elektronik.
MENGELOLA SUMBER DAYA DATA
SISTEM BASIS DATA.
MATERI SISTEM PENGOLAHAN DATA
Sistem Basis Data.
MENGIDENTIFIKASI STRUKTUR HIRARKI BASIS DATA
Sistem Basis Data - Universitas Semarang
BASIS DATA DAN SISTEM MANAJEMEN BASIS DATA
SISTEM BERKAS Pengenalan Moh. Saefudin , S.Kom, MMSi.
DATABASE SYSTEM (Sistem Basis Data)
SISTEM BASIS DATA Materi Pertemuan ke-8
Basis Data - Udinus Semarang
HIERARKI DATA DAN PENYIMPANAN SEKUNDER (SASD & DASD )
Dukungan database dalam Pembangunan Sistem Informasi
SISTEM BASIS DATA Materi Pertemuan ke-8
DATABASE DAN MANAJEMEN DATABASE
Kelompok 3 : Neti Wijayanti 2112R0510 Andi Irawan 2112T0503 Nita ferawari 1111S0353 Muh.Abdul Rouf ( )
DATABASE DAN MANAJEMEN DATABASE
SISTEM BASIS DATA Dr. Kusrini, M.Kom.
SISTEM BASIS DATA.
Pertemuan 8 SISTEM BASIS DATA Renni Angreni, M.Kom.
Sistem Basis Data.
Perancangan umum Sistem Informasi
SISTEM BASIS DATA Dr. Kusrini, M.Kom.
Database dan Sistem Manajemen Database
BAB XIII BASISDATA.
Universitas Gunadarma
BAB VI SISTEM BASIS DATA DAN SISTEM BERORIENTASI OBJEK
Pengenalan Sistem Basis Data
Database dan Sistem Manajemen Database
BASIS DATA 1 KONSEP DATA & FILE.
BASIS DATA 1 KONSEP DATA & FILE.
Database Manajemen System Dinda Prasetia,Skom.
SISTEM BASIS DATA.
SISTEM BASIS DATA.
SISTEM BASIS DATA Materi Pertemuan ke-8
DBMS Basis Data Pertemuan 2.
Konsep Teknologi Informasi B
PENGANTAR BASIS DATA M6.
PENGANTAR BASIS DATA PERTEMUAN 1.
Pengantar Basis Data Pertemuan I Betha Nurina Sari, M.Kom
Sistem Informasi Psikologi
Sistem Informasi Akuntansi
PENGELOLAAN DATA Roni Kurniawan M.Si.
Sistem Basis Data (Kuliah 2)
Universitas Gunadarma
Management Information System
SISTEM BASIS DATA Materi Pertemuan ke-8
Pemrograman terstruktur
DIAGRAM HUBUNGAN ANTAR ENTITAS (ERD)
Pengantar Basis Data.
SISTEM BASIS DATA Basis Data.
DATABASE DAN MANAJEMEN DATABASE
PERTEMUAN I “EHAT PERMANA”
SISTEM INFORMASI AKUNTANSI
Pengantar Basis Data.
DATABASE DAN SISTEM MANAJEMEN DATABASE
Oleh : Imam Gunawan, M. Kom
SISTEM BASIS DATA Kuliah - 2.
TUGAS AKHIR PERANCANGAN PROGRAM PENJUALAN DAN PEMBELIAN BARANG ELEKTRONIK SECARA TUNAI PERANCANGAN PROGRAM PENJUALAN DAN PEMBELIAN BARANG ELEKTRONIK.
BAB XIII BASISDATA.
SISTEM BASIS DATA Basis Data.
SISTEM BASIS DATA Dr. Kusrini, M.Kom.
SISTEM PENGOLAHAN DATA
KONSEP BASIS DATA Ricak Agus Setiawan, S.T.
SISTEM INFORMASI AKUNTANSI
Transcript presentasi:

Database dan Sistem Manajemen Database 10 Database Media dan Sistem Penyimpanan Data Sistem Pengolahan Organisasi Database

Database Data adalah fakta baik dalam bentuk angka-angka, hurup-hurup atau apapun yang dapat digunakan sebagai input dalam proses untuk menghasilkan informasi Fakta merupakan hasil persepsi manusia tentang peristiwa yang dapat diindranya/diamatinya Fakta bukan merupakan data untuk saat ini tetapi dapat menjadi data pada saat yang lain demikian pula sebaliknya

Interpretasi merupakan faktor yang sangat menentukan dalam menilai fakta dan data Data yang dibutuhkan tergantung kepada informasi yang diperlukan dan proses yang harus dilakukan Tiga macam data menurut Date: Input data adalah data yang dimasukkan ke dalam sistem informasi Output data merupakan keluaran dari sistem informasi Database merupakan kumpulan data-data yang tersimpan didalam media penyimpanan di suatu perusahaan (arti luas) atau di dalam komputer (arti sempit)

Media dan Sistem Penyimpanan Data Main strorage merupakan media penyimpan utama Secondary storage merupakan media penyimpan tambahan Media penyimpanan data sekunder terdiri dari: Media penyimpanan data berurutan Media penyimpanan data langsung

Media Penyimpanan Data Secara Berurutan (Pita Magnetik) Pita magnetik terbuat dari plastik bercampur zat tertentu dan sebagian besar berbentuk seperti kaset yang sering digunakan untuk merekam lagu Saat pita magnetik menyimpan satu record Kosong Kosong mahasiswa Nomor Nama Alamat Tanggal lahir

Penyimpanan data dalam pita magnetik Data yang direkam akan dicatat berdasarkan bit-bit, dimana bit-bit itu mewakili tiap karakter dan disusun melintang terhadap lebar pita. Setiap record biasanya memiliki kerapatan mencapai 1.600 bit per inci (bpi) Penyimpanan data dalam pita magnetik Label kepala Record 1 Record 2 Penggandeng Label Record n Ujung Pita Kosong

Read/Write head ditempatkan pada 12 cylinder Media Penyimpanan Secara Langsung - DASD DASD (Direct Acces Storage Device) - Media yang dapat digunakan untuk menyimpan secara langsung data ke nomor record yang kita inginkan 0012 Cylinder Access arm Read/Write head ditempatkan pada 12 cylinder Track 0012 Permukaan 1 Permukaan 7

Ada 4 cara untuk menentukan alamat record, yaitu: Sequential Direct /Random - Hashing - Indexed sequensial Sequential adalah teknik yang digunkan untuk menyimpan dan membaca data secara berurut Random adalah teknik yang digunakan untuk menyimpandan membaca data secara langsung

Hashing merupakan teknik yang digunkan untuk menentukan alamat record dengan menggunakan rumus Hashing memberikan banyak kesulitan dalam menambahdan menghapus data Indexed Sequential adalah menentukan alamat record dengan menggunakan index

Memasukan data transaksi Memperbaharui data pada DASD Memperbaharui file master Data transaksi Memasukan data transaksi File master transaksi Menyimpan data tarnsaksi

Sistem Pengolahan Ada dua cara mengolah data yang biasa dilakukan dalam sistem manajemen data saat ini, yaitu pengolahan secara Batch dan pengolahan secara on-line Pengolahan secara batch (penumpukan lebih dahulu) merupakan sistem pengolahan data transaksi dengan cara mengumpulkan terlebih dahulu data transaksi yang terjadi, kemudian pada waktu yang telah ditentukan secara sekaligus memproses data transaksi tersebut, biasanya sambil memperbaharui file master Pengolahan secara on-line merupakan pengolahan secara langsung begitu data dimasukan kedalam suatu sistem informasi

Memperbaha-rui file master Pengolahan Secara On-Line Memperbaha-rui file master Memasukkan satu record transaksi File Persediaan Piutang Hutang Aplikasi menentukan jenis pengolahan apa yang harus digunakan Sistem Realtime merupakan sistem yang bisa memberikan informasi kepada pemakai ketika suatu transaksi berlangsung

Organisasi Database Organisasi data pada database tradisional memiliki tujuan agar sistem Informasi secara efektif memberikan informasi yang akurat, relevan, tepat waktu dan lengkap Masalah pada data base tradisional adalah: Data rangkap dan tidak konsisten Kesulitan dalam akses data Data terisolasi sulit diakses bersamaan Masalah keamanan Masalah integritas

Hirarki Data Database Contoh File Gaji File Alamat File Tarip File Nama Alamat Umur Dine Jl. Panghegar 18 Bandung 28 Shelly Jl. Polisi 8 Bandung 30 Maman Jl. Thamrin 12 Jakarta 20 Record Doni Jl. Dipatiukur 350 Bandung 18 Field Bambang Sutopo (nama pada sebuah field nama) Byte 0100 0001 (Hurup A dalam ASCII) Bit 0 1

Sistem database modern memberikan banyak keuntungan bagi sistem informasi manajemen Manajemen data meliputi: Mengumpulkan data Menjaga dan mengadakan pengujian terhadap Integritas data Menyimpanan data Memelihara data Mengamankan data Mengorganisasikan data Mencari data

Sistem database merupakan sistem pencatatan dengan menggunakan komputer yang memiliki tujuan untuk memelihara informasi agar selalu siap pada saat diperlukan Sistem Database Melalui bahasa pencarian (Structure Query Language/SQL) Database Data Pemakai Jaringan Komunikasi Program aplikasi dalam Foxpro, Oracle, Clipper

Komponen sistem database adalah: - Hardware - Software - Pemakai Data dalam sistem database harus selalu terintegrasi dan dapat diakses oleh siapa saja yang berhak Bagian hardware dari sistem database meliputi : Kepala (Head) dan Prosesor (Processor)

Ada tiga kelas pemakai dalam sistem database yaitu: Programmer , pemakai akhir (end user) dan database administrator

Record Statistik Penjualan Model-model Data Model Hirarki (Hierarchical data model) - Model data yang menggam-barkan hubungan antara data berdasarkan kepada tingkatannya Record Wiraniaga Record Statistik Penjualan Record Pelanggan Record Piutang Dagang No. Wiraniaga Nama Wiraniaga No. Kantor penjualan Dll. Link ke record statistik penjualan Link ke record pelanggan No. Pelanggan Nama Pelanggan Batas kredit Link ke record statistik Wiraniaga Link ke record Piutang dagang No. Jenis barang Jumlah penjualan Link ke record Wiraniaga No. Faktur Tanggal Faktur Nilai Faktur

Model Network (Network data model) - Model data yang menggambarkan hubungan antar data berdasarkan kepentingannya Record Pelanggan Wiraniaga Statistik Penjualan Piutang Dagang Record Wiraniaga No. Wiraniaga Nama Wiraniaga No. kantor penjualan dll. Link ke statistik penjualan dll. Link ke record pelanggan Link ke record piutang dagang Record Pelanggan No. Pelanggan Nama Pelanggan Batas Kredit Link ke record Wiraniaga Record Statistik Penjualan No. jenis barang Jumlah penjualan Record Piutang Dagang No. Faktur Tanggal Faktur Nilai Faktur Link ke record statistik penjualan

Model Relasi (Relational data model) - Model data yang disusun berdasarkan kepada hubungan antar dua entitas (entity) .a2 .a1 .a3 .a4 .b1 .b2 .b3 .b4 Tingkat hubungan Satu ke satu .a1 .a2 .b1 .b2 .b3 .b4 Tingkat hubungan Satu ke banyak .a2 .a1 .a3 .a4 .b1 .b2 .b3 .b4 Tingkat hubungan banyak ke banyak .b1 .b2 .a1 .a2 .a3 .a4 Tingkat hubungan Banyak ke Satu

ERD (Entity Relationship Diagram) menggambarkan data dalam keadaan diam, nama entity biasanya menggunakan kata benda sedangkan untuk relasi menggunakan akar kata dari kata kerja Model ERD Peter Chen (Awal) Atrribut Kode langganan Nama Langganan Alamat Telp Fax Mak kredit Kode Produk Nama Produk Satuan Min level Saldo awal Harga beli Harga jual Kode order Tanggal 1:M 0:M 1:1 0:M Tingkat hubungan Pelanggan Buat Order Produk isi

Model ERD Peter Chen yang lainnya Atribut Kode order Tanggal Buat Baris oder Milik Barang Isi Atribut Pelanggan Kode langganan Nama Langganan Alamat Telp Fax Mak kredit Atribut Barang Kode Barang Nama Barang Satuan Min level Saldo awal Harga beli Harga jual 1:1 1:M 0:1 Pelanggan Order

Model ERD Martin Pelanggan Membuat Dibuat oleh Anggota Bukan anggota Order Baris order Barang Membuat Dibuat oleh Berisi Dipunyai oleh Diisi

Model ERD Bachman Dipunyai oleh Baris order Barang Membuat Dibuat oleh Pelanggan Anggota Bukan anggota Diisi pada Berisi Order